A whale lifeless was found in the last hours in the vicinity of the coast of Buenos Aires, almost a week after another cetacean’s body was found in a nearby areawithout even knowing the causes of their deaths.
The sighted whale late Monday It was struck in shallow waters of the Río de la Plata and several meters from the shoreon the northern coast of the Argentine capital.
Miguel Íñiguezholder of the Cethus FoundationHe told The Associated Press on Tuesday that the animal is young and of the SEI species, as was the one that was spotted on Wednesday of last week in waters that bathe the nearby municipality of Vicente López.
The SEI species is in danger of extinction, although for a few years its population is recovering. Adult specimens reach 20 meters in length.
The CETHUS Foundation and the Argentine Museum of Natural Sciences jointly investigate the causes of death and the approximation of the two young cetaceans on the banks of the Río de la Plata.
The body of the first whale, which was sighted days ago, has been carried in a sea, to an area chosen by the Naval Prefecture authorities, after they were extracted samples for its study.
Several hypotheses about animal death are analyzed. “We do not know if on the immigration route they have diverted for some storm or by some disease, and that has weakened them taking them river inside, which is not their normal habitat, and there they have died; or if they have suffered any collision with boats,” explained the naturalist.
Argentina is part of the immigration route of these animals, from the waters of the South Atlantic to the Brazilian coasts. Young specimens are already independent and move in herds of two or three individuals.
It is unknown when the results of the studies carried out to the whales will be.
